The platform is structured around smart-contract-based escrow workflows that aim to replace informal off-chain trades with verifiable on-chain settlement, ensuring that assets are held in escrow until predefined trade conditions are met. This approach is intended to reduce disputes and fraud, improve price discovery for niche asset classes, and provide buyers with cryptographic provenance and trade history for increased confidence. The project progressed through staged testing in 2025, running a documented Closed Beta from 2025-05-21 to 2025-06-12 and launching an Open Beta on 2025-06-20. TAKE is represented as a BEP-20 token on BNB Smart Chain and is tracked on aggregator platforms such as CoinMarketCap and CoinGecko. Technically, OVERTAKE combines on-chain primitives with application-layer tooling. Core components described in available documentation include smart-contract escrow for conditional transfers, on-chain metadata recording for provenance and auditability, and AI-driven market utilities for pricing analysis, listing suggestions, and market insights. As an EVM-style token on BNB Smart Chain, most consensus, node, and block-level responsibilities are handled by the underlying chain rather than the token itself. The supplied materials do not include low-level technical artifacts such as chain ID, token decimals, or audited contract verification links; those omissions limit the ability to independently verify contract bytecode or on-chain tokenomics from the supplied snapshot. The project emphasizes regulatory and platform-standard compliance and cites monitoring of applicable frameworks across jurisdictions, but it does not disclose detailed governance or legal entity structure in the provided materials. In terms of use cases, OVERTAKE is explicitly targeted at buyers and sellers of digital goods—particularly game assets—who require provenance and dispute-reduction mechanisms. Use cases include marketplaces for rare items, account transfers, and secondary markets where verifiable transaction history and escrow reduce counterparty risk. The AI components are designed to assist sellers with pricing and to surface market intelligence for buyers, improving liquidity and reducing information asymmetry in long-tail markets.
